Indoor Social Leagues at Grace Chapel
LPC Social Leagues
Lexington Pickleball Club’s Social Leagues (SL) embody the essence of LPC as a pickleball social club. Held at Grace Chapel from mid-September thru early May, the Social Leagues are weekly 1 ½ or 2-hour leveled play sessions that run in 4 to 7-week blocks depending upon holidays and school vacation schedules (when Grace is unavailable). Regardless, the players remain together as a core group for the duration of the SL block.
The cost of a Social League is the same as a bundled open play session, $10 per session, so a 6-week SL is $60, a 5-week SL is $50 and so on. The only difference is that you pay for the block of sessions up front and are guaranteed a spot each week.
Why should I join a Social League?
Since players enroll for the entire SL block, they can skip the hassle of waitlists, bundles or worrying about getting into a session.
Playing with the same core group each week helps to build a community of trust, support, camaraderie and friendship.
Since there are SLs for every level, they provide members with the unique opportunity to play with others at the same skill level and evaluate their own rating level.

How do I join a Social League
Joining a SL is different from signing up for an open play session.
It involves a 2-step process:
Step I:
Sign up Below: Go to the drop-down box (on this page). Use the down arrow to scroll to find the SL for your level. Click on the level. Add the SL to your cart and make your payment.
PLEASE NOTE- Each player may only sign up for ONE SL per series!
Step 2:
Sign up for Individual Sessions on PlayTime Scheduler (PTS): Within a day or two, you will receive an email from the LPC Social League Coordinator (Ronni Skerker) and a Playtime Scheduler invitation asking you to add your name to each of the SL sessions on PTS. Why do we ask you to do this? Because LPC cannot add your name to a PTS play list. You must do this yourself using your own PTS account. (If you know ahead of time that you cannot make a certain date, you can either sign up and find a substitute player or skip that week.)
What if I am unable to attend one of the Social League sessions?
If you are unable to attend a session you may do one of the following:
Remove your name from the SL play list so that someone may move off the waitlist. PLEASE do this as soon as possible to give the WL player adequate notice. The player coming off the waitlist will be charged for the session by LPC.
Give your spot to a designated player AT THE SAME LEVEL, in which case, we ask that you put a note in PTS letting the session manager know you are not playing and who is taking your spot. The player taking your spot is NOT charged for the session by LPC.
PLEASE NOTE: LPC does not provide refunds for sessions or get involved in any exchange of payment between players.
What if I can’t commit to join the entire Social League?
Remaining spots (if available) will be open to everyone approximately 10 - 11 days prior to the start of the session.
If you sign up for a spot, the fee is $15 per session, or you can purchase and use a LPC bundled session. Like open play sessions, you must cancel by 6 PM the evening prior to avoid a charge if you can’t attend.
